Experts in Power Supply Module Repair
Precision Zone specializes in the repair services of power supplies. Our highly trained team of engineers and technicians evaluate and inspect every repair job and our superior customer care team helps keep you informed and up to date with your entire repair process so that you know exactly when it will be completed.
All power supply repairs are done on-site in our 72,000 square foot, state of the art repair facility. Once our repair team starts on the job, we use specialized and customized testing fixtures, Huntron trackers, signal generators, oscilloscopes, milli and mega ohm meters, as well as any other necessary tools we have available to assure quality repair work.

Precision Zone Power Supply Repair Benefits
- Free Quotes and Evaluations
We have a thorough evaluation process that utilizes visual, static, and power tests to determine the failure of the product so you get a comprehensive and accurate quote. Everytime.
- 12-Month Warranty
All products are covered by our comprehensive warranty that includes our parts and labor. Warranty terms and conditions are product specific.
- Competitive Pricing
We know that you have many different options to go to for your repairs. However, we pride ourselves in being able to provide you with a more affordable and competitive repair option with out sacrificing the quality of service we provide.
- Flexible Rush Repair Options
To minimize your equipment downtime, we offer mutliple rush repair options. Standard repair time is typically 1-2 weeks. Rush repair options include 3 day, 2 day, next day, and even same day repairs.
